Israel 'ready to withdraw' from northern Ghajar

BEIRUT: Israel has informed the United States that it is prepared to withdraw from the northern side of Ghajar village, the Israeli daily Haaretz reported on Monday. Describing Israel's remarks as "a change in its policy for the past year and a half of not wanting to discuss the issue," the paper quoted an unidentified "government source in [Occupied] Jerusalem [who] said the decision was made after the Lebanese government delivered written assurances that UNIFIL [the UN Interim Force in Lebanon] would be given security and civilian control over the northern part of the village, which is in Lebanese territory."...
